Typical cost $45,000 – $200,000
Per sq ft $200–$275 / sq ft
Timeline 3 to 6 months
Resale ROI Master suite 50–60%, bathroom addition 53–60%, deck 65–75%.
Cost note Mid-range $200–$275/sq ft; high-cost metros (SF, NYC) reach $600–$750/sq ft.

Jacksonville market

Additions in Jacksonville: what the market looks like

Riverside and Avondale are Jacksonville's premium renovation neighborhoods, with 1920s–1940s Mediterranean and Colonial Revival housing actively restored. Naval Station Mayport and NAS Jacksonville create sustained military-family renovation demand. St. Johns River floodplain affects some parcels; flood-zone awareness is essential before any foundation or site work. Florida Building Code compliance including wind mitigation is the baseline.

Permits in Jacksonville

Duval County and City of Jacksonville have a consolidated government, simplifying permit routing. Florida Building Code (8th Edition) governs all construction including wind-resistant requirements for coastal proximity. Wind mitigation reports affect insurance premiums, so the firms we match document all qualifying measures explicitly. Flood elevation certificates are required for affected parcels.

Jacksonville conditions

What additions projects in Jacksonville actually take

An addition in Jacksonville only reads as original when the new foundation, rooflines, and finishes are matched to the existing house, which is where most amateur additions give themselves away. The new structure has to meet local wind-load requirements, so connections and uplift detailing are engineered for the storm zone.
